Output 39f60319c918890c83f6f517a13c192636a2cf128612b15bf1f06a11f46c5942:5

value
216585044
script pubkey
OP_0 OP_PUSHBYTES_32 d1b38492b7a5f84f0a374f54d4541dd0694e9c7dbf5708e5467d88a5c1fa5b10
address
bc1q6xecfy4h5huy7z3hfa2dg4qa6p55a8rahats3e2x0ky2ts06tvgq58vrj9
transaction
39f60319c918890c83f6f517a13c192636a2cf128612b15bf1f06a11f46c5942
spent
true